Are people in Glocester older or younger than people in Somers?
- The Median Age in Glocester is 0.5 years older than in Somers.

Are housing costs cheaper in Glocester or Somers?
- Glocester housing costs are 5.9% more expensive than Somers hous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Glocester or Somers?
- The average commute for residents of Glocester is 4.4 minutes longer than it is for residents of Somers.
